(Independence, Oregon) — During the month of March, Independence police join agencies across the state in providing sustained speed enforcement throughout our cities.

Independence officers participate in several grant-funded traffic safety enforcements throughout the year focused on a range of concerns on the road, including seatbelt and car seat use, pedestrian safety, DUII, distracted driving, and speed. The goal is to educate drivers and change behavior, leading to safer roadways for all of us. This enforcement is made possible thanks to federal funding from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, in partnership with Oregon Impact.
Since October 2023, Independence police have written 76 speeding tickets and issued 28 warnings.

Independence police would like to remind everyone about the dangers of speeding, which can result in crashes, injuries, and death.
